7

24.8 km

Inn at the Rhine Ferry Zons

Highlight • Restaurant

Two-storey residential and guest house built in 1838 in four axes. Dating by anchor pins. Plastered brick. The barn dates from the 19th century. Conversions and additions took place in 1926, 1950 and 1970.
